Daily Responsibilities & Insights

As a Hotel & Travel Executive, day-to-day activities include guest interaction, order taking, and coordination with team members.

Expect to help guests with queries and ensure all requests are handled in a timely, professional manner.

Keeping track of bookings and supporting daily hotel operations are key aspects of the job.

You may also be required to take part in team meetings and handle customer feedback.

Work is guided by senior staff, but proactiveness and attention to detail are highly valued.

Potential Cons to Consider

Peak business hours may require you to work in the evenings, on weekends, or at odd times.

The role can be physically demanding and fast-paced, especially during busy periods.

Customer-facing jobs sometimes mean dealing with difficult individuals or unexpected situations.

Salary at the entry level may not suit highly experienced professionals expecting premium compensation.

Competition for promotions could be high if many staff are eager for advancement.
